The Benefits of Vitamin C for Skin
Vitamin C presents a multitude of benefits for skin health. Here's a detailed look at how this powerhouse vitamin can enhance your complexion and overall skin resilience.
1. Antioxidant Protection
At the forefront of Vitamin C's efficacy is its powerful antioxidant properties. Antioxidants neutralize free radicals—unstable molecules that can cause cellular damage and aging. Regular application of Vitamin C helps combat oxidative stress from environmental aggressors like UV rays and air pollution.
- Why It Matters: By protecting the skin from these damaging factors, Vitamin C helps maintain skin integrity and youthful appearance, reducing the risk of fine lines and wrinkles.
2. Brightening and Evening Skin Tone
Vitamin C is acclaimed for its ability to brighten dull skin and even out skin tone. It does this by inhibiting melanin production, thereby reducing the appearance of dark spots and hyperpigmentation.
- Clinical Evidence: Studies have highlighted that regular use of Vitamin C can significantly improve skin discoloration, making it a beloved ingredient for those struggling with uneven skin tone.
3. Promotes Collagen Production
Collagen, a critical protein responsible for skin structure and elasticity, diminishes with age. Vitamin C is essential for stimulating collagen production, which helps preserve skin firmness.
- Impact on Aging: Enhancing collagen levels can render the skin firmer and more youthful, which is particularly beneficial for those looking to reduce signs of aging.
4. Reduces Inflammation and Acne
Vitamin C also exhibits anti-inflammatory properties, making it beneficial for skin prone to acne. It can help lower redness and swelling associated with breakouts and may even reduce sebum production.
- For Clearer Skin: Incorporating Vitamin C into an acne-prone skin regimen can promote balance and clarity.
5. Enhances Effectiveness of Sunscreen
While Vitamin C is no substitute for sunscreen, studies reveal that it enhances the effectiveness of sunscreen in protecting the skin from UV damage.
- Combined Strategy: Using Vitamin C in conjunction with a broad-spectrum sunscreen can optimize your skin’s defense against harmful rays.
6. Accelerates Wound Healing
Vitamin C is linked to promoting healing of minor wounds and potentially reducing the visibility of scars.
- Real-Life Impacts: Whether from acne or a sunburn, Vitamin C can assist in healing and improving skin texture.
How to Choose the Right Vitamin C Product
With various Vitamin C formulations in the market, selecting the right one might seem overwhelming. Here are a few essential guides to ensure your choice delivers optimal results:
1. Active Ingredient Form
Seek products containing L-ascorbic acid, the most bioavailable and studied form of Vitamin C. Other forms like sodium ascorbyl phosphate or magnesium ascorbyl phosphate may not yield the desired benefits.
2. Concentration Levels
Look for concentrations in the range of 10% to 20% for effectiveness. While lower concentrations may be less irritating, higher concentrations may lead to discomfort.
3. Packaging Integrity
Vitamin C degrades in light and air. Opt for products in tinted or opaque bottles, preferably with pump dispensers to minimize exposure and maintain potency.
4. Additional Supporting Ingredients
Some Vitamin C serums are paired with Vitamin E and ferulic acid to enhance stability and provide superior protection against oxidation.
Incorporating Vitamin C Into Your Skincare Routine
Effective skincare is all about layering products properly. Here’s how to incorporate Vitamin C seamlessly into your routine:
Morning Routine Steps
-
Gentle Cleanser: Cleanse your face with a gentle cleanser to remove impurities.
-
Vitamin C Serum: Apply a few drops of your chosen Vitamin C serum to your face and neck. We recommend starting with every other day to allow your skin to adjust.
-
Moisturizer: Lock in hydration with a suitable moisturizer that suits your skin type.
-
Sunscreen: Always finish with a broad-spectrum sunscreen, as this will offer maximum protection against UV damage while complementing the protective effects of Vitamin C.
Evening Routine Steps
-
Cleanser: Use a gentle cleanser to remove any makeup or daily impurities.
-
Supplement with Other Actives: If you're using products like retinol or exfoliating acids, apply those in the evening, maintaining space between applications to prevent irritation.
-
Reapply Vitamin C: You can also use Vitamin C at night, but applying it in the morning can enhance its protective benefits against the day’s aggressors.
-
Hydrating Night Cream: Follow with a hydrating night cream to nourish your skin overnight.
Anticipating Results
It's important to be patient. Results from Vitamin C can take time to manifest, with noticeable changes typically occurring after three months of consistent use as part of an established regimen.

FAQ
1. Can I use Vitamin C every day?
Yes, Vitamin C can be used daily, but start slowly if you have sensitive skin. Daily use can enhance brightness and skin defense upon consistent application.
2. What should I expect when using Vitamin C?
You may initially notice enhanced radiance and brightness. Long-term benefits include reducing dark spots and improving skin texture.
3. Is it safe for all skin types?
Vitamin C is generally safe for most skin types, although those with sensitive skin may want to begin with lower concentrations.
4. Can I mix Vitamin C with my other skincare products?
It’s best to apply Vitamin C prior to other serums or creams, especially when using it alongside other actives like retinol. Space out their application to avoid skin irritation.
5. How should I store my Vitamin C products?
Keep Vitamin C products tightly sealed and stored in a cool, dark place to preserve potency and effectiveness.
